我已经安装了Android应用程序。我第一次跑它 OAuth2窗口出现了,问我是否要批准 应用程序访问我的用户帐户中的某个范围。
但是现在我去了https://accounts.google.com/b/0/IssuedAuthSubTokens?hl=en 和撤销访问,但我的应用程序仍然正常运行而不问我 是否允许其访问我的帐户的问题。
该应用程序是Google Play附加功能附带的示例Auth活动。
如何让应用程序再次在弹出窗口中显示问题? 我已经尝试卸载并重新安装,但我无法恢复该窗口,我需要 它用于测试目的。
感谢。
答案 0 :(得分:2)
尝试通过向 - https://accounts.google.com/o/oauth2/revoke发出请求以编程方式撤消令牌,并将令牌作为参数包含在内。像这样的东西::
curl https://accounts.google.com/o/oauth2/revoke?token= {token}
令牌可以是访问令牌或刷新令牌。如果令牌是访问令牌并且它具有相应的刷新令牌,则刷新令牌也将被撤销。
如果成功处理了吊销,则状态代码为 响应是200.对于错误条件,状态代码400是 返回错误代码。
错误代码可以让您了解撤销是否成功。